> This patch adds a test to test if multi stream using libcamera's
> gstreamer element works.
>
> We need to work around one issue with ASan when enabled in the
> build:
>
> - glib has a known leak at initialization time. This is covered by the
> suppression file shipped with glib, but it's not clear how to use it
> automatically. For now, disable leak detection to avoid test failures.

> + /*
> + * GStreamer by default spawns a process to run the
> + * gst-plugin-scanner helper. If libcamera is compiled with ASan
> + * enabled, and as GStreamer is most likely not, this causes the
> + * ASan link order check to fail when gst-plugin-scanner
> + * dlopen()s the plugin as many libraries will have already been
> + * loaded by then. Fix this issue by disabling spawning of a
> + * child helper process when scanning the build directory for
> + * plugins.
> + */
> + gst_registry_fork_set_enabled(false);

Is there a guarantee that libcamerasrc will pick the same camera ? It
seems quite fragile to me. Isn't there a way to instead query the
libcamerasrc element for the number of pads it supports ? More than
that, as not all cameras support multiple streams, it would be nice if
the test could iterate over all cameras to find one that does.
